As for your problem it could be caused by settings in the map properties box, the level series thing where it asks if this level is part of another or if the level is to clear prevoius levels in the series... Not sure really because I've never made a single player campaign ![]()

I do SP, and I think I know what your problem might be.
Firstly, your info_landmark MUST have a short name, best to be 5 or fewer letters. It must also have the same name at both ends. Secondly, you MUST have the setup avaiable on the other level to go back to the original one, or bad things will happen - even if it is impossible to actually reach the previous level (e.g. you could have all of the entities required for going back to the other level locked away in a box), you still need them there.
